— A working palette
We choose materials that age rather than perform — surfaces that look better in their second decade than their first.
Lime plaster
#F4EDE0 · matte, breathing
Belgian linen
#E8DCC4 · raw, undyed
Unlacquered brass
#B08862 · patinas over time
Soapstone
#2A2823 · darkens with oil
Rift white oak
#C0A378 · soaped finish
Travertine
#D6C9B3 · honed, not filled
Ivory
#F8F6F1 · for ceilings, cotton
Burnt clay
#7A4E2E · a single accent

— How a commission unfolds
A long visit to the house. We watch how light moves and ask many questions. No fee.
A mood book — references, swatches, plans. Three to five weeks. Refundable against the work.
We source the room — vintage hunts, custom commissions, millwork. We oversee install on site.
A single afternoon of styling — art, textiles, ceramics. We return six months later to revisit.
